A Poem by Cassidy Mask

 

I have a little friend

He lives in the cupboard

Under the stairs

And every time

I’m on the computer

The door pops open

And I know

That he’s there

Watching me

 

I never see him

And when

I take a peek

Through the crack

All I see is

The jumble

Of boxes

Mops and

Plastic Bags

 

But he is there

Always there

Always watching

Never seen

 

Under the Stairs
